Bent

Profile:
Electronic duo from Nottingham, England. They are the founders of Sport Records.

Friend and vocalist Katty Heath features on a few of their albums and has toured very frequently with the live group.

Elton John has also confessed to being a fan.

Post-house outfit Bent spoon-feed you chilled, pop-friendly delights dripping with trendy yet appealing sound textures and inventive knob-twiddling techniques. Dreamy lo-fi arrangements piece together bottomless synths with lazy beats and past-remembering vocal loops to envelop your consciousness in comfort. Future-looking cuts employ featherweight melodies to wrestle with fatigued rhythms, creating a magical electronic listening experience known only to those that frequent Ibiza in the summertime. Inviting grooves that ask you to lie back and doze....they'd rub your tired feet if they could!

If you are a fan of the "Lounge" , downbeat or experimental downbeat genre , bent is definately worth a listen.

High quality Synths mixed with voice samples from old records really brings out a style of music that is hard to find ... if not impossible to match. They have a sound simular to Air ...

This music grows on you , and i can definately say that its not something for the mainstream listener or the person that wants music to instantaniously grab him/her.

But once you notice the beauty of the music you will find yourself hunting down every Bent album that you can find.

I would suggest trying "music for BBQ's " as a starting point ... it would give you a brief overview of the sound that Bent produces. (but this is in no way their definative album , its just got my fav track on it ;)

My favourite songs are swollen , Duke thing and always. To me these are Really superb tracks ... give it a listen.
